Innovation Challenge 2023 – Future of Energy for Mobility

Dated: June 12, 2023

Plastic Omnium’s Innovation Challenge the Future of Energy for Mobility in partnership with SoScience is officially open for applications to accelerate innovation leveraging collective intelligence, through an open innovation approach.

Donor Name: Plastic Omnium

Country: Global

Type of Grant: Grant

Deadline: 07/07/2023

Size of the Grant: up to 150 000€

Details:

The Innovation Challenge is open to Plastic Omnium’s employees as well as experts, entrepreneurs, engineers, academics, researchers, public sectors, cities to shape the future of energy for mobility.

Aims

  • The aim is to develop innovative energy solutions for mobility that are environmentally friendly, safe, sustainable throughout their entire lifecycle, and adaptable to meet the needs of all users worldwide.
  • To create multi-actor collaborations around projects to explore sustainable research and innovation solutions with a positive impact.

Benefits

  • For all applicants selected for the meet-up day event:
    • Get access to an international network of innovators and find new partners;
    • Include social and environmental impact in your projects;
    • Find new applications to your projects;
    • Disseminate your results;
    • Accelerate your projects.
  • 3 collaborative projects will be awarded and will get access to:
    • 6 months coaching from SoScience;
    • A financial contribution from Plastic Omnium;
    • Your free project page on SoScience platform.

Eligibility Criteria

  • They are looking for experts of all kinds:
  • Companies, Academic researchers, Start-ups, Social Entrepreneurs, Non Profit Organizations and Associations, Public Organizations, Cities, Artists…
    • start-up / an entrepreneur: bring an innovative solution or approach to this problematic;
    • working for an industrial company: find new potential partners to accelerate the research & innovation projects or learn from them;
    • researcher (every kind of science): working on something that can help solve the problem develop research partnerships with other actors;
    • an association / an NGO: set up a local program with other partners;
    • public policy actor: experiment with a project locally or co-design new tools;
    • provide services (funding, acceleration of innovation): boost promising projects, help your community identify new development opportunities;
    • an artist or art collective: like to propose new ideas and means to raise awareness about the problematic.

Timeline

  • Phase #1
    • Sourcing & Selection
    • Call for applications and international targeted sourcing
      • 1st wave – Program open to application – April 5 to May 31
      • Webinar on May 16th
      • Selection of up to 30 candidates on June 7
      • 2nd wave – Open for missing profiles – from June 8 to July 7
      • Selection of up to 10 additional candidates on July 19
  • Phase #2
    • Projects Structuration
    • Meet 50 experts on September 19, share and network, imagine new multi-actors projects to answer the program challenge
      • Meet-up day in Paris on September 19 with 50 experts
      • Structuration of proposals – September 19 – October 6
      • Selection of 8 finalists – October 11
      • Pitch and award ceremony – November 14
  • Phase #3
    • 6 Months Support (Minimum)
    • Coaching by SoScience & fundings by PlasticOmnium
      • Align stakeholders’ vision
      • Integrate Social & Environmental Impact
      • Fundings up to 150 000€
